NLEX recovered and rediscovered its stroke in crunch time to shrug off pesky Phoenix, 120-115, in overtime to finally earn a win in the 2018 Philippine Basketball Association Commissioner’s Cup at the Alonte Sports Arena in Binan, Laguna.

After a collapse late in regulation that led to the extra period, the Road Warriors kept their poise and turned in a strong finish.

NLEX opened overtime on a 9-2 run, with five points coming from Alex Mallari, to take a critical 113-106 lead with over three minutes remaining.

Unlike in the fourth period where it allowed the Fuel Masters to force overtime, the Road Warriors closed out well in the extension to finally crack the winning column.

The scores:

- Advertisement -

NLEX 120—Moultrie 37, Quiñahan 16, Mallari 13, Fonacier 11, Ravena 9, Miranda 8, Baguio 7, Soyud 7, Tiongson 5, Rios 4, Monfort 3, Ighalo 0.

PHOENIX 115—Wright 31, White 18, Chan 17, Perkins 15, Revilla 9, Mendoza 8, Jazul 8, Kramer 4, Eriobu 2, Chua 2, Alolino 0, Wilson 0, Intal 0.

Quarterscores: 28-25, 57-43, 78-72, 104-104, 120-115 (OT).
